NRG Energy Stock Performance
NYSE:NRG opened at $132.16 on Thursday. NRG Energy, Inc. has a 1 year low of $120.11 and a 1 year high of $189.96. The firm has a 50 day moving average of $143.24 and a 200-day moving average of $153.05. The company has a current ratio of 0.84, a quick ratio of 0.78 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 4.68. The stock has a market capitalization of $27.89 billion, a P/E ratio of 155.49 and a beta of 1.24.
NRG Energy (NYSE:NRG –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, May 6th. The utilities provider reported $1.48 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.78 by ($0.30). NRG Energy had a net margin of 0.74% and a return on equity of 70.67%. The firm had revenue of $10.26 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$8.43 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ted $2.68 EPS. The business’s revenue was up 19.5% on a year-over-year basis. NRG Energy has set its FY 2026 guidance at 7.900-9.900 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that NRG Energy, Inc. will post 8.98 EPS for the current fiscal year.
NRG Energy Dividend Announcement
The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, May 15th. Shareholders of record on Friday, May 1st were paid a $0.475 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, May 1st. This represents a $1.90 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.4%. NRG Energy’s payout ratio is currently 223.53%.
NRG Energy Profile
NRG Energy (NYSE: NRG) is a U.S.-based integrated power company headquartered in Houston, Texas. The company develops, owns and operates a diversified portfolio of power generation assets and participates in wholesale and retail energy markets. NRG supplies electricity to utilities, commercial and industrial customers, and retail consumers, while also providing energy-related products and services designed to manage consumption and support reliability.
NRG’s generation mix includes conventional thermal plants as well as renewable and distributed energy resources.
